Candidates must apply for the TSTET 2022 via the TSTET's official website. Paper-I and Paper-II are the two papers that makeup TSTET. Paper-I is required for individuals wishing to teach in primary schools, whereas Paper-II is required for those wishing to teach in secondary schools. Applicants for the Telangana State Teacher Eligibility Test 2023 must apply through TSTET's official website. Only online applications are accepted. The following is a step-by-step guide to completing the TSTET 2023 application form.
The TSTET Exam has an application fee of INR 200. The application fees must be paid online using any online payment mechanism, such as a debit card, credit card, or net banking.
After submitting the application, the official authority will issue the exam admit card in an online format, which candidates must download. Candidates must check the details mentioned on the admission card after downloading it. The Telangana Teacher Eligibility Test admission card contains information such as the name of the exam, the year, the exam day and time, the timing, the examination centre, what is allowed and what is not allowed in the examination grounds, and other vital instructions. On the day of the exam, candidates must print their hall ticket and bring it with them, along with a valid ID card. Any defaulter who does not have an admit card will be sent away by the invigilators.
Candidates can find the basic details related to TSTET 2023 in the below table:
Particulars | Details |
Name of Exam | TSTET (Telangana State Teachers Eligibility Test) |
Conducting Authority | Department of School Education, Telangana Government |
Exam Level | State Level |
Exam Frequency | Annually |
Mode of application | Online |
Application Fees | INR 200 |
Mode of Examination | Offline |
Number of Papers | 2 |
